Jackpot Digital secures record eight-table Pechanga deployment

The agreement extends the supplier’s US tribal casino expansion after new deals in Arizona and regulatory approval in Louisiana.

Jackpot Digital has signed an agreement to deploy eight Jackpot Blitz electronic poker tables at Pechanga Resort Casino in Temecula, California, representing its largest order for a single casino property.

The installation will place the supplier’s dealerless multiplayer poker product within one of California’s largest tribal gaming venues. Pechanga operates approximately 200,000 square feet of gaming space with 5,500 slot machines and more than 150 table games. The resort is owned and operated by the Pechanga Band of Indians. 

Jackpot Blitz uses a 75-inch touchscreen to automate functions normally handled by a live poker dealer. The system supports cash games and tournaments while providing game management and reporting functions. 

Jackpot Digital markets the tables under a recurring revenue model, with each installed unit contributing monthly revenue to the supplier.

Pechanga plans to support the introduction through tournaments, promotions and other events. Jackpot Digital will provide technical and customer support during the installation, although a launch date was not disclosed.

The agreement continues Jackpot Digital’s expansion across tribal and commercial casino markets. In May, it signed a master agreement with Gila River Gaming Enterprises covering potential deployments across four Arizona properties, beginning with two tables at Wild Horse Pass. 

The supplier also agreed to install three tables at Penn Entertainment’s Hollywood Casino at Greektown after receiving approval to enter Michigan’s commercial casino market. In March, Louisiana regulators granted Jackpot Digital manufacturer and supplier permits, allowing it to serve licensed casinos across the state. 

These agreements add to an existing network of installations across US tribal casinos, commercial properties and cruise ships. Jackpot Digital’s previous California activity includes deployments at Chumash Casino Resort, Gold Country Casino Resort and Jackson Rancheria Casino Resort. Its corporate records also show orders and installations across Wisconsin, Michigan, Minnesota, Montana and New York.

California’s tribal casinos operate Class III games through tribal-state compacts or procedures approved by the US Department of the Interior. The framework gives tribal operators access to casino games that are subject to tighter restrictions in the state’s commercial cardrooms.

Jackpot Digital CEO, Jake Kalpakian, said: “This commitment reflects the growing confidence that leading casino operators are placing in our technology.”

Pechanga expanded its table games portfolio in May when Galaxy Gaming introduced its Monopoly Poker progressive at the property, following the casino’s selection as the launch venue for Konami Gaming’s Red Fortune Rail slot series earlier in 2026.
